Table of Contents
-
Introduction
-
What Makes Dolibarr Unique as a Modular ERP/CRM
-
Why Module Selection Directly Impacts Productivity
-
The Hidden Cost of Underusing Dolibarr’s Potential
-
CRM and Agenda: The Foundation of Business Efficiency
-
Project Management and Task Modules: Organize Workflows
-
Invoice, Orders, and Payments: Automating the Cash Flow
-
Email Templates and Notification Automation
-
Time Tracking and HRM for Small Teams
-
Stock and Inventory Modules That Save Hours Weekly
-
Document Management for Smarter Collaboration
-
Advanced Reporting and KPI Dashboards
-
Supplier and Procurement Tools You Shouldn’t Ignore
-
Barcode and POS Modules for Retail or Warehouse Environments
-
Custom PDF Templates to Reinforce Brand and Save Time
-
Multi-Currency and International Trade Modules
-
Why Expense and Leave Modules Matter for Microbusinesses
-
Mobile Access and Progressive Web App Support
-
External Connectors (WooCommerce, Stripe, etc.)
-
Integrating Dolibarr with Cloud Storage and Backup
-
Security and Audit Logs: Safeguarding Your Productivity
-
Using Scheduled Tasks and CRON to Automate Routine Work
-
Avoiding the "Too Minimal" Dolibarr Trap
-
Building a Productivity-First Dolibarr Setup
-
Conclusion: Don’t Let Dolibarr’s Simplicity Limit Your Success
1. Introduction
Dolibarr is a favorite ERP/CRM for small and growing businesses thanks to its modular structure and open-source flexibility. But simply installing Dolibarr and enabling the basic modules isn’t enough to reap its full productivity potential. If you’re using Dolibarr without the right supporting modules, you’re likely wasting hours each week on manual processes, duplicated efforts, or missed opportunities.
This article is your guide to unlocking productivity by using the most impactful modules that many Dolibarr users overlook.
2. What Makes Dolibarr Unique as a Modular ERP/CRM
Dolibarr isn't like rigid all-in-one ERP systems. Its modular design lets you enable or disable only the features you need. This keeps the interface clean and performance fast. However, many users leave powerful modules disabled simply because they don’t explore far beyond the basics.
3. Why Module Selection Directly Impacts Productivity
Productivity in an ERP environment depends on automation, accuracy, and speed. Modules directly affect how:
-
Data flows between departments
-
Actions are triggered automatically
-
Users avoid redundant work
Missing even one key module—like email automation or inventory tracking—can introduce inefficiencies that compound over time.
4. The Hidden Cost of Underusing Dolibarr’s Potential
Here’s what you’re risking by not enabling key modules:
-
Manual invoice reminders instead of automated alerts
-
Phone tag with team members instead of centralized tasks
-
Spreadsheet chaos when managing stock
-
Missed deadlines and lost leads due to scattered information
5. CRM and Agenda: The Foundation of Business Efficiency
CRM Module: Centralize your leads, clients, and prospects. Use it to:
-
Set follow-up reminders
-
Record calls, notes, and proposals
-
Convert leads into quotes or invoices
Agenda Module: Synchronize tasks and meetings. Key benefits:
-
Visible team calendars
-
Automated task creation from client interactions
These are essential for staying organized.
6. Project Management and Task Modules: Organize Workflows
Many businesses neglect these modules unless they’re service-based, but they benefit any team that:
-
Manages deadlines
-
Assigns responsibilities
-
Tracks progress
Create a project per client or campaign. Link tasks to documents, quotes, and emails. Use Gantt charts for visibility.
7. Invoice, Orders, and Payments: Automating the Cash Flow
It’s easy to enable invoicing but miss the modules that surround it:
-
Commercial Proposals for pre-invoice client commitments
-
Customer Orders for internal tracking before invoicing
-
Payments and Bank for reconciling with actual receipts
You save time and avoid missed payments by creating a natural flow.
8. Email Templates and Notification Automation
The Email Templates module lets you:
-
Create standard replies for quotes, invoices, and reminders
-
Personalize messages with variables
-
Standardize communication across your team
Combine this with automatic triggers for late payments, new proposals, or project updates.
9. Time Tracking and HRM for Small Teams
Enable:
-
Time Tracking Module: Log hours per user, task, or project
-
HRM Module: Track employee profiles, contracts, and skills
-
Leave Requests: Approve and manage absences
Even small teams benefit from this clarity.
10. Stock and Inventory Modules That Save Hours Weekly
If you sell or store physical items, these are crucial:
-
Products and Stock modules for quantities
-
Warehouse Locations to split inventory
-
Stock Movement to track inbound/outbound
This avoids lost items and incorrect customer delivery promises.
11. Document Management for Smarter Collaboration
The Document Module lets you attach files to:
-
Clients
-
Invoices
-
Projects
No more scattered files across email threads or local folders. Keep everything centralized, searchable, and linked.
12. Advanced Reporting and KPI Dashboards
The native reporting tools are decent, but often underused. You can:
-
Create custom reports with SQL
-
Visualize KPIs per user or module
-
Export insights for financial and operational review
Or integrate with Power BI or Metabase using Dolibarr’s REST API.
13. Supplier and Procurement Tools You Shouldn’t Ignore
Suppliers aren’t just names in a database. With the right modules, you can:
-
Track supplier orders and delivery dates
-
Record supplier invoices
-
Compare costs per vendor
This streamlines procurement and pricing strategies.
14. Barcode and POS Modules for Retail or Warehouse Environments
For physical product environments:
-
POS Module for retail counters
-
Barcode Scanner Add-ons to update inventory
-
Label Printing for shelves or shipping
These modules speed up checkout and reduce stock errors.
15. Custom PDF Templates to Reinforce Brand and Save Time
Forget editing documents manually. Use the PDF module to:
-
Auto-brand proposals and invoices
-
Add VAT or legal disclaimers
-
Create consistent document layouts for all clients
This also improves your professional image.
16. Multi-Currency and International Trade Modules
For global business:
-
Enable Multi-currency to quote and invoice in foreign currencies
-
Use regional VAT settings
-
Translate invoice templates for international clients
Great for freelancers, agencies, or eCommerce sellers.
17. Why Expense and Leave Modules Matter for Microbusinesses
Even if you’re a solo operator:
-
Track out-of-pocket expenses
-
Assign project budgets
-
Log time-off or availability for clients
These help you plan capacity and cash flow better.
18. Mobile Access and Progressive Web App Support
You can use Dolibarr on a smartphone, but better with:
-
Mobile-optimized themes
-
Third-party apps like DoliDroid or MyDoli
-
PWA configuration for offline-ready access
This makes on-the-go operations practical.
19. External Connectors (WooCommerce, Stripe, etc.)
Don’t manage orders twice. Connect via modules:
-
WooCommerce Sync for eCommerce stores
-
Stripe and PayPal Integration for instant payments
-
Zapier or Make for workflow automation
A must-have for digital or hybrid businesses.
20. Integrating Dolibarr with Cloud Storage and Backup
For file redundancy and team access:
-
Use modules for Google Drive, Dropbox, or WebDAV
-
Automate daily backups to the cloud
-
Enable encrypted document sharing
This protects your data and enables remote work.
21. Security and Audit Logs: Safeguarding Your Productivity
Install:
-
Audit Log Pro (from Dolistore)
-
IP logging and two-factor login modules
-
User activity tracking
It’s easier to fix problems when you can trace what happened.
22. Using Scheduled Tasks and CRON to Automate Routine Work
Enable automated jobs:
-
Email reminders for overdue invoices
-
Inventory updates every night
-
CRM follow-ups based on inactivity
These eliminate dozens of manual tasks.
23. Avoiding the "Too Minimal" Dolibarr Trap
Dolibarr is lightweight by design, but many users mistake simplicity for minimalism. If you never explore beyond invoices and contacts, you're running at half speed.
Worse, you may be duplicating work that Dolibarr could automate.
24. Building a Productivity-First Dolibarr Setup
Checklist:
-
Start with essential workflow modules
-
Add CRM, project, and stock tools as needed
-
Activate automation and scheduling
-
Use PDF and document templates
-
Track team time and leave
-
Review usage monthly and optimize
The right mix transforms Dolibarr from a tool into an operational engine.
25. Conclusion: Don’t Let Dolibarr’s Simplicity Limit Your Success
Dolibarr is powerful, but only if you unlock that power. Many businesses underuse it because they don’t explore or experiment. By enabling key modules—especially those for automation, collaboration, and reporting—you’ll not only save time, but scale faster, improve accuracy, and impress clients.
If you’re still using Dolibarr with just a few modules, it’s time to rethink. The tools are already there. You just have to switch them on.